What are Wall Mounted AC Units?

Wall mounted AC units are air conditioners that are mounted on the wall, as opposed to being placed on the floor or a window. These AC units can provide a more efficient cooling solution than traditional window units, as they take up less space and are easier to install. They are also quieter than other types of air conditioners, as the compressor is located outdoors and the fan is located inside.

Disadvantages of Wall Mounted AC Units

While wall mounted AC units offer many advantages, there are also some disadvantages to consider, including:

  • Cost – Wall mounted AC units can be more expensive than traditional AC units, as they require more specialised installation and require a dedicated outdoor unit. This makes them more of an investment than a standard window unit.
  • Size – Wall mounted AC units are typically larger than window units, meaning they take up more space. This can be an issue if you have limited wall space or are looking for a more discreet cooling solution.
  • Maintenance – Wall mounted AC units require regular maintenance and cleaning to ensure they are functioning properly. This can be time-consuming and require professional help.

Things to Consider When Buying a Wall Mounted AC Unit

When buying a wall mounted AC unit, there are a few things to consider, such as:

  • Size – The size of the unit is important, as it needs to be able to effectively cool the space. You should measure the area you want to cool and then select a unit that is suitable for the size of the room.
  • Efficiency – Look for a unit with a high energy efficiency rating. This will help you save money on your energy bills in the long run.
  • Noise – Wall mounted AC units are typically quieter than other types of air conditioners, but it is still important to consider the noise level when selecting one. Make sure to check the dB rating of the unit to ensure it is quiet enough for your needs.
